Eel-fishing, pig-stalking, and skating in the back country: life on a New Zealand sheep station had its sport. Lady Barker, writing from her own colonial years, tells how settlers amused themselves between the hard work of buying and running a run. Bright, funny, and full of frontier flavor. The lighter side of pioneering at the ends of the earth.
